LOCASH Biography

news-detailsLOCASH, the high-energy country music duo, rose from the vibrant Nashville scene to become hitmakers known for their anthemic party songs and heartfelt ballads. Originally formed under the name LoCash Cowboys, the pair consists of Preston Brust and Chris Lucas, who forged their partnership not from a shared hometown but from a shared dream in Music City. Their journey is a testament to perseverance, having built a loyal fanbase through years of relentless touring and songwriting before achieving mainstream chart success.

The duo's origins trace back to Nashville, Tennessee, where both members had independently pursued music. Chris Lucas, a native of Baltimore, Maryland, and Preston Brust, hailing from Kokomo, Indiana, met while working at the famed Wildhorse Saloon. Bonding over their love for traditional country and contemporary rock, they began performing together, initially adopting the name LoCash Cowboys. They built their reputation the hard way, playing countless live shows and honing their craft as songwriters for other artists. Their early breakthrough came as writers, penning the number-one hit "You Gonna Fly" for Keith Urban in 2011, which announced their formidable talent behind the scenes.

After signing with Reviver Records and shortening their name to LOCASH, they released their self-titled debut EP in 2014. Their commercial breakthrough arrived with the 2015 single "I Love This Life," a celebratory anthem that cracked the Top 10 on the Billboard Country Airplay chart. This success was swiftly followed by their highest-charting single to date, "I Know Somebody," which soared to the top of the Country Airplay chart in 2016. These hits formed the core of their first full-length major-label album, "The Fighters" (2016), which showcased their blend of infectious rhythms and resilient storytelling. The album's title track, "The Fighters," became another fan favorite, resonating for its message of perseverance.

Their momentum continued with the 2019 album "Brothers," which featured the platinum-selling, number-one hit "One Big Country Song" and the heartfelt "Feels Like a Party." LOCASH has consistently been recognized for their dynamic stage presence and hit-making ability, earning nominations for awards including the Academy of Country Music and CMT Music Awards. They have collaborated with a diverse range of artists, including Tim McGraw on the track "Hometown Girl" and pop singer Sofia Reyes. Known for their electrifying concerts, LOCASH remains a staple on the country music touring circuit. They continue to release new music, further cementing their status as one of country's most durable and enthusiastic duos, always aiming to bring a party and a positive message to their audience.
